REQUESTING THE PUBLIC UTILITIES COMMISSION TO CONDUCT A COMPREHENSIVE ANALYSIS ON THE BEST PATHS TO MAXIMIZE COST REDUCTION AND MINIMIZE FINANCIAL RISK TO HAWAII RESIDENTS WHILE MEETING STATE GOALS.

Summary

The concurrent resolution directs the Hawaii Public Utilities Commission to hire experts and produce two independent analyses on ways to reduce energy costs and minimize financial risk for consumers while meeting the state’s renewable‑energy goals through 2055. The Commission must deliver a preliminary report before the 2027 regular session and a final report before the 2028 session, including any legislative recommendations. The effort is intended to guide future energy policy and avoid costly reliance on imported fuels.
